Management Accountant Responsibilities:
• Prepare management accounts for the company and its subsidiaries
• Ensure that all accruals, prepayments, and depreciation is recorded
• Track inventory levels and costs, and oversee regular stock take processes
• Reconcile VAT, balance sheet accounts, and intercompany transactions
• Work across departments to assist with budgets
• Collaborate with Auditors on year-end reporting and statutory accounts
• Lead and mentor a team, sharing your finance and management accounting knowledge
• Perform regular one-to-ones and performance reviews, and handle all day-to-day team management
• Compile financial data to generate reports and provide actionable insights
